Mathiasen Earns Conference Honors March 4, 2003 Fullerton, Calif.
Cal State Fullerton senior All-Arounder Kelly Mathiasen earned Western
Gymnastics Conference Athlete of the Week honors on Tuesday morning after
leading the Titans to a season-best performance against Southern Utah
last Friday night.
It is the second honor of the season of Mathiasen and the third of her
career after earning Athlete of the Week honors once as a junior.
Mathiasen broke her own school record in the all-around with a 39.600
and won three events this past week against the Thunderbirds. She tied
her career high on vault with a 9.90 and took home first-place honors
on bars (9.875) and beam (9.90). Her previous career high in the all-around
with 39.450 set earlier this year in a narrow loss to UCLA on Jan. 17.
The only event she did not win was the floor exercise where Titan junior
Latoya Milburn broke a 10-year old school record with a 9.975 to break
Celeste Delias mark of 9.950 on Mar. 20, 1993. Mathiasen finished
second in the event with a 9.925.
Mathiasen now owns nine of the top 10 all-around scores in the history
of the program.
